It is a simple linear equation in 's'. Its solution is the number that 's' must bein order to make it a true statement. The solution may be found like this:4s + 10 = 2s + 2Subtract 10 from each side of the equation:4s = 2s - 8Subtract 2s from each side:2s = -8Divide each side by 2 :s = -4
